How many rental units are there in the US?

In 2020, there were approximately 43 million housing units occupied by renters in the United States. This number has remained steady since 2014, but is part of a long-term upward swing since 1975.

What does number of units mean when buying a house?

The count of housing units in a structure is the total number of units in the structure, both occupied and vacant units. In the tabulations, occupied mobile homes or trailers, tents, and boats are included in the category one housing unit in structure.

Who owns the most rental units?

The largest owner of apartments in the United States is Tennessee-based real estate investment trust MAA, who owned 100,031 apartments as of 2020.

Is a townhouse a house or a unit?

A townhouse is a multi-level building designed to mimic a traditional house that is owned on a strata title. This means you own the dwelling but share the land with other people.

What is a 4 unit home?

Fourplex properties are multi-family homes that contain 4 apartment units. These medium-sized buildings have become increasingly popular with real estate investors.
